Flu Vaccination at UZH 2023

Starting at the end of October 2023, Safety, Security and Environment will offer all UZH employees the opportunity to be vaccinated against the seasonal flu. The vaccination is free of charge and voluntary.

The vaccination can only be offered to UZH employees.
Students, relatives and external persons can receive the vaccination at pharmacies or by their family doctor, at their own expense. 

National flu Vaccination day: Friday the 10th of November 2023.

This year we are conducting the flu vaccinations without registration. There may be a waiting time.

  • Bring your employee ID card and vaccination booklet with you to the appointment
  • Avoid coming to the vaccination appointment if you show any symptomsof an acute respiratory disease or other acute illnesses
  • If you have any questions, please contact the SU Office (044 63 54410 or info@su.uzh.ch).

2023/2024 Vaccine

At the UZH the quadrivalent vaccine VaxigripTetra® will be used. WHO recommends that vaccines contain the following:

- A/Victoria/4897/2022 (H1N1) pdm09
- A/Darwin/9/2021 (H3N2)
- B/Austria/1359417/2021
- B/Phuket/3073/2013
